Meaning & Etymology
The name Oakley originates from an English surname derived from various place names meaning 'oak clearing' in Old English. It signifies a connection to nature, particularly oak trees, and reflects the historical importance of oak clearings in English landscapes.
Etymology
Original Form:
Old English 'āc' (oak) + 'lēah' (clearing)
Evolution:
The name evolved from a descriptive term for a geographical feature to a surname and eventually became a given name.
Source:
Old English
